微软开源项目NeuronBlocks介绍

微软开源项目NeuronBlocks介绍

【免费下载链接】NeuronBlocks NLP DNN Toolkit - Building Your NLP DNN Models Like Playing Lego 【免费下载链接】NeuronBlocks 项目地址: https://gitcode.com/gh_mirrors/ne/NeuronBlocks

NeuronBlocks 是微软推出的一款自然语言处理(NLP)深度学习建模工具包。该项目旨在帮助工程师和研究人员构建端到端的神经网络模型训练管道,以应对各种 NLP 任务。NeuronBlocks 使用 Python 编程语言开发。

核心功能

NeuronBlocks 的核心功能包括两部分:Block Zoo 和 Model Zoo。

  • Block Zoo:提供常用的神经网络组件作为构建块,用于模型架构设计。
  • Model Zoo:提供一系列用于常见 NLP 任务的模型,以 JSON 配置文件的形式存在。

该项目支持多种 NLP 任务,包括句子分类、情感分析、问答、文本匹配、文本蕴含、槽位标注、机器阅读理解和知识蒸馏模型压缩等。

最近更新功能

根据项目的更新日志,最近的更新可能包括以下几个方面:

  • 优化了模型构建和参数调整流程:用户可以通过编写简单的 JSON 配置文件来构建和调整模型参数,进一步简化了模型开发流程。
  • 增强了模型的共享和复用性:通过 JSON 文件的形式,用户可以轻松分享模型,减少了冗余的代码编写。
  • 提高了平台兼容性:NeuronBlocks 能够在 Linux 和 Windows 系统上运行,支持 CPU 和 GPU 计算,同时也支持在 GPU 平台如 Philly 和 PAI 上进行训练。
  • 增加了模型可视化工具:提供了模型可视化器,帮助用户在调试过程中轻松查看模型架构。

NeuronBlocks 的持续开发和完善使其成为一个强大的工具,特别是在简化 NLP 任务中的深度学习模型开发方面。开源社区的贡献将进一步推动该项目的进步。

【免费下载链接】NeuronBlocks NLP DNN Toolkit - Building Your NLP DNN Models Like Playing Lego 【免费下载链接】NeuronBlocks 项目地址: https://gitcode.com/gh_mirrors/ne/NeuronBlocks

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值